Most common Renault 20 MOT faults
These are the faults and advisories recorded most often across Renault 20 MOT tests:
- Nearside Rear Tyre worn close to the legal limit (4.1.E.1) (5 times)
- Offside Rear Tyre worn close to the legal limit (4.1.E.1) (5 times)
- Front brake disc worn, pitted or scored, but not seriously weakened (3.5.1i) (5 times)
- Play in steering rack inner joint(s) (4 times)
- Nearside Front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m (4.1.E.1) (4 times)
- Nearside Front Tyre worn close to the legal limit (4.1.E.1) (4 times)
- Offside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ively (8.2.2) (4 times)
- Nearside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ively (8.2.2) (4 times)
- Rear brake disc worn, pitted or scored, but not seriously weakened (3.5.1i) (4 times)
- Registration plate lamp not working (1.1.C.1d) (3 times)
- Nearside Front position lamp(s) not working (1.1.A.3b) (3 times)
- Offside Front position lamp(s) not working (1.1.A.3b) (3 times)
- Offside Track rod end ball joint has slight play (2.2.B.1f) (3 times)
- Offside Track rod end ball joint has excessive play (2.2.B.1f) (3 times)
- Exhaust emissions carbon monoxide content after 2nd fast idle excessive (7.3.D.3) (3 times)
